					<description><![CDATA[<p>The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has postponed its governorship primary election in Anambra State from Friday, April 5, to Monday, April 8, 2025. Chairman of the PDP in the state, Mr. Chidi Chidebe, confirmed the development to journalists in Awka on Saturday. 					<description><![CDATA[<p>Philip Shaibu, the Deputy Governor of Edo State, has emerged as the winner of a factional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) primary election. The primary was held for the September 21, 2024 governorship election.
